Certificate in Extraterrestrial Resource Exploitation: Essentials
-- viewing nowThe Certificate in Extraterrestrial Resource Exploitation: Essentials is a comprehensive course designed to equip learners with the necessary skills for the rapidly growing field of space resource utilization. This program highlights the importance of understanding and utilizing extraterrestrial resources to support future space missions, satellite servicing, and lunar/Mars-based infrastructure.

Course Details
• Space Law and Policy: An introduction to the legal and regulatory framework governing extraterrestrial resource exploitation, including national and international laws, policy considerations, and ethical dilemmas. • Astrophysics and Space Science: An overview of the fundamental principles of astrophysics and space science, including celestial mechanics, gravity, orbits, and space weather. • Space Technology and Engineering: An exploration of the technology and engineering required for space missions, including spacecraft design, propulsion systems, navigation, and communication. • Extraterrestrial Resource Exploration and Mining: A deep dive into the methods and techniques used for detecting, extracting, and processing extraterrestrial resources, such as water, minerals, and rare elements. • Sustainable Space Development: An examination of the strategies and best practices for developing and utilizing space resources in a sustainable and responsible manner, including environmental impact assessments, resource management, and planetary protection. • Economics of Space Resources: An analysis of the economic and financial aspects of space resource exploitation, including market analysis, business models, and cost-benefit assessments. • Space Entrepreneurship and Innovation: An overview of the emerging trends and opportunities in the space industry, including entrepreneurship, innovation, and public-private partnerships. • International Cooperation and Diplomacy: An exploration of the role of international cooperation and diplomacy in space resource exploitation, including multilateral agreements, partnerships, and conflict resolution mechanisms.
